Explain how to find the LCM of 8 and 10

Respuesta :

celluslawrence30 celluslawrence30
  • 13-01-2021

Answer: Start by listing the first five multiples of each number. Then circle the common multiples. Finally, identify the least of these common multiples. The LCM of 8 and 10 is 40.
